Community Structure

A well-designed community structure is essential for building resilience against ratio strain. Here are some key considerations for community structure:

Aspect Description
Clear Moderation Guidelines Establishing clear moderation guidelines is crucial for maintaining a community that is welcoming to users and resistant to harassment and spam. Ensure that these guidelines are communicated clearly and consistently enforced.
Flexible Category System A well-designed category system should allow for flexibility in terms of topic discussion and community engagement. This helps to prevent a situation where a single topic dominates the community.
Community Feedback Mechanisms Providing community feedback mechanisms, such as surveys and polls, helps to gauge user sentiment and identify areas for improvement.
Community Governance Establishing community governance structures, such as community managers and moderators, helps to ensure that the community is well-maintained and continues to grow.

User Incentives

User incentives are essential for building a resilient community. Here are some key considerations for user incentives:

Aspect Description
Clear Value Proposition Communicating the value proposition clearly to users is essential for attracting and retaining community members. Ensure that the value proposition is tailored to the user’s needs and interests.
Community Rewards and Recognition Implementing community rewards and recognition systems, such as badges and leaderboards, helps to motivate users and encourage participation.
Quality Content Promotion Promoting quality content within the community helps to engage users and foster a sense of ownership and shared knowledge.
User Feedback and Engagement Providing regular user feedback and engaging with community members helps to build trust and maintain a sense of community.
